Miroshevsky V. Devitsa Vsevolozhskaya, or Pictures of Russian life in the XVII century. - St. Petersburg. In The Printing House Of N. Grech. [2], 186 p., 1 folding sheet of music, not included in the pagination. 1839 Combined hardcover, Lasse, size (12 x 17 cm). Binding worn, tears at the spine; splits block for bookends; have undergone restoration [reprinted reproduced by way of the title sheet and insert of notes]; the loss of leaves on the free endpapers and on page 31, not affecting the text; on the flyleaf inscriptions in ink, pencil; on nachsatz trace of erased pencil drawing, lettering; significant time and household stains to pages; print Maritime library in Kronstadt, and inventory numbers. [Miroshevsky, Vasily-novelist and playwright, author of a novel from the life of the XVII century. ”The maiden Vsevolozhskaya” (St. Petersburg, 1839) and original comedies: ”Remonter” (went to St. Petersburg in 1839) and ”an Unusual masquerade for the new year” (Moscow, 1841).]
